Abstract

The invention belongs to the technical field of air conditioners, and provides a self-cleaning control method for the air conditioner. The method aims to solve the problems that in general, an existing self-cleaning control mode of the air conditioner is low in frosting speed, so that the whole self-cleaning time is long, and the normal experience of a user is influenced. The air conditioner comprises a cold medium circulation system and a solution circulation system formed by an indoor solution film, an outdoor solution film, a liquid pump and a liquid storage box; and the self-cleaning control method comprises the following steps that under a refrigeration working condition, the frequency of a compressor is reduced and a four-way valve is reversed; the frequency of the compressor is raised and the rotating speed of the liquid pump is raised so as to frosting an outdoor heat exchanger; after the outdoor heat exchanger is frosted, an electronic expansion valve is closed firstly, and then a solenoid valve on the low-pressure side of the compressor is closed after a preset period of time; and the outdoor heat exchanger is heated so as to defrosting and cleaning the outdoor heat exchanger. The method can improve the efficiency of self-cleaning on the outdoor heat exchanger and improve the user experience.

technical field [0001] The invention belongs to the technical field of air conditioners, and specifically provides a self-cleaning control method for an air conditioner. Background technique [0002] The air conditioner is a device that can cool / heat the room. As time goes by, the dust accumulation on the indoor and outdoor units of the air conditioner will gradually increase. , which is exposed to the outdoors for a long time, making the dust and bacteria from the outside easily adhere to the outdoor unit. Such bacteria and dust will seriously affect the heat exchange efficiency of the air conditioner, increase the energy consumption of the air conditioner, and reduce the service life of the air conditioner. , so it is necessary to clean the air conditioner in time. [0003] In the prior art, the cleaning methods of the air conditioner include manual cleaning and self-cleaning of the air conditioner. It is time-consuming and labor-intensive to use manual cleaning.
